Key Takeaway

raw, yellow onions (whole unpeeled), intended for food service, in 50-lb corrugated boxes by Taylor Farms Colorado, Inc. was recalled on October 22, 2024. The hazard: Potential contamination of E. coli O157:H7

Hazard / Reason

Potential contamination of E. coli O157:H7

Class I: Dangerous or defective product that could cause serious health problems or death.

Class I is the most serious recall classification used by the FDA, indicating a reasonable probability of serious health consequences or death.

Distribution

To food service facilities in CO, KS, MO, NE, NM, UT
